The Japan Display Panel Market was estimated at USD 161 Million in 2025 and is projected to reach USD 173 Million by 2032, growing at a CAGR of 1.0% from 2026 to 2032. This growth trajectory is primarily driven by the increasing demand for energy-efficient and high-resolution display technologies across various sectors including consumer electronics and automotive. Moreover, the push towards innovative form factors, such as flexible and foldable displays, further strengthens this market outlook.

The Japan Display Panel Market faces notable constraints, particularly from fierce competition posed by manufacturers in South Korea and China, who often provide equivalent technology at more accessible price points. This pressure necessitates continuous innovation and a strong emphasis on technological advancement among Japanese companies. Additionally, the rapid pace of changing consumer preferences and technological progress creates a challenging environment, demanding that manufacturers remain agile and responsive to market dynamics. Fluctuating demand across various applications, such as smartphones, TVs, and automotive displays, also adds a layer of complexity, impacting overall market stability.

The Japanese government plays a pivotal role in fostering the growth of the display panel market. Through various subsidies and grants, the government encourages ongoing research and development in display technologies, while also providing funding to support the construction of new manufacturing facilities. Policies aimed at promoting energy efficiency and environmental sustainability in display production align with global trends and further bolster the industry's commitment to eco-friendly practices. Additionally, government initiatives to enhance the competitiveness of domestic manufacturers against international rivals are crucial for ensuring that Japan remains a leader in the global display panel sector.
